32. What Are You Doing, Your Highness?

Translator: Antonia

The tealeaves coming suddenly scared everyone. The first one to understand were those who followed Ashina Yi all year round. Discovering Ashina Yi’s expression, they struggled to stop their movements.

In this split second, Du Chuxuan quickly reacted, trying his best to get up and desperately running out. Not that he didn’t want to save Ada, but because he really didn’t have any more strength for that. There remained in his mind one single thought, that was to rush out and live.

Coincidentally, he was running in the direction where Yuxing Tianrui had escaped. Anyway, he didn’t have much strength left and could only automatically run forward as the last thought in his mind told him.

When Yuxing Tianrui stopped, he could no longer hear the sound of yelling and killing. He leaned on a stone to take a rest. Somehow, the scene where Du Chuxuan pushing him out of the siege began to replay in his mind.

Since he had memory, he had been saved countless times. However, neither the imperial guards in the palace, nor Ada who followed him all the time, nor even the servant girl who once protected him from a shooting dagger with her own body, touched him more than today.

He subconsciously touched his chest. Just now, if the saber had cut into his body instead of Du Chuxuan, he would die. But they were all human made of flesh and blood. She must be very painful now. Would she get out?

In an instant, many thoughts flashed in his mind. With anxiety, he wanted to walk back.

He, Yuxing Tianrui, wasn’t a coward.

The failure was caused by his wrong command. Therefore, he deserved to die on the battlefield, like those great men who shed blood there. He had no reason to escape alone!

Yet, before he got on his feet, he coughed heavily due to his violent movement. After a long while, he sighed and sat back, the dissatisfaction against himself obvious in his dark eyes.

Time flies. Du Chuxuan didn’t know how long he had run. Basically, he alternately stood up to run for a while and lay on the ground when he ran out of energy. All supported him was a belief to live.

But at this moment he had another belief, that was to find the old man and let him teach his good disciple some good lessons. Why didn’t he just enjoy being a prince but thought about how to kill his sect-brother?!

The sky was getting darker and there seemed to be no sound of people chasing after him, so Du Chuxuan found a piece of relatively soft grassland and lay on it, completely relaxed and passed out.

It was when Yuxing Tianrui walked back that he spotted Du Chuxuan on the grassland. Seeing his princess covered with blood and remembering how a clean person turned into this all for him, Yuxing Tianrui felt an immediate stab of heartache.

Gritting his teeth and enduring the pain, he stepped forward and struggled to carry up the person. He was about to check Du Chuxuan’s wound, when there was sound of a few soldiers catching up, so in a fluster, he cautiously took her to get on a byway and ran.

The chasers’ story should go back to when Du Chuxuan had just fled. Ashina Yi was poisoned by Yuxing Tianrui and fought hard to stay sober. Seeing Du Chuxuan ran away, he was rested assured and at once passed out.

The people around were all Ashina Yi’s close guards. When he passed out, they didn’t have the intention to see where the two men had gone and rushed to Ashina Yi to check on him.

The battle just ended in such a hasty way. Shenglan Army suffered a great loss, but the generals and soldiers didn’t know yet that their Crown Prince had disappeared and retreated.

Ashina Yi wasn’t necessarily lucky to survive. Actually, Yuxing Tianrui hadn’t planned to kill him at all. Therefore, the poison used on him was merely something making people uncomfortable but not fatal. A slightly famous doctor was able to cure it soon. By dawn, when Ashina Yi woke up, the first thing he did was ordering people to find Du Chuxuan.

He remembered that Du Chuxuan was seriously injured when he escaped. In the wilderness, if Du Chuxuan was eaten by wild tigers or leopards, his head wouldn’t be enough for their shifu to cut off for eighteen times.

Although Du Chuxuan was lazy, he was the apple of the eye of their shifu. At this moment, Ashina Yi didn’t want to admit that he worried about Du Chuxuan.

Yuxing Tianrui was fortunate as always. Soon after he took on the byway, he saw a cave that he accidentally stumbled his way into.

As the voice of searching getting closer and closer, Yuxing Tianrui hurriedly took Du Chuxuan to hide in and then stuffed the entrance with grass and branches to make it more covert.

After two exceedingly hard hours the searching sound finally died away and he was able to breathe a sigh of relief. They finally survived this.

Now it was late at night, with no sound around at all, expect for the occasional cricket cries.

Yuxing Tianrui gazed down at Du Chuxuan and his eyes turned bleak immediately. This person was tall and dressed in white. Now with jarring bleeding cuts here and there on her body, she seemed like a broken flower, making people feel sorry for her.

He reached out to feel Du Chuxuan’s forehead and was taken aback by the frightening heat. Needless to say, it must be so because of the wounds that hadn’t been treated with for a long time. Yuxing Tianrui hesitated for a long time and still couldn’t convince himself to take off her clothes.

“We’re a married couple, and I’m just trying to save her!” Yuxing Tianrui hesitated and chanted the mantra to himself. Nonetheless, every time his hand was going to touch Du Chuxuan’s belt, he couldn’t help taking it back.

Du Chuxuan happened to frown and groan in pain, instantly scaring Yuxing Tianrui to sit up, back straight, lest she might misunderstand.

Du Chuxuan had a terrible fever, but his psyche was pulled tense. Therefore, soon after he passed out, he forced himself to open his eyes, and the first thing he saw was Yuxing Tianrui sitting square next to him.

“What are you doing, Your Highness?” He turned slightly to glance around. It was dim. But for the faint light from outside, he would have thought that Yuxing Tianrui really locked him in a dark cellar. After all, this was what Du Chuxuan believed Yuxing Tianrui would do all the time.
